As it stands now, the development page is a rather clumsy affair. Players can click on and start developments without fully knowing what they do, lock or unlock unless they spend time reading the manual. There are also only two categories - Research and Construct - which only make limited sense. I propose a slight change to the development page which will make it slightly more user-friendly.
First, two super categories need to be implemented, Route-specific and Generic. Within these two categories, additional Research and Construct sections could be present (or eliminated altogether if still cluttered), listing specific research or construct developments.
Within the Generic category, all researches which are available to anyone should be placed - Engineering, Intelligence options, Geo-Phys, Tractors, Combines, etc.
Conversely, every route-specific development would be placed under the Route-specific category.
This will clear up a lot of confusion about what dev. does what.
Furthermore, if a player has not started a route development yet, the first options present would be re-labelled as "Military Route", "Spec-Ops Route", so on and so forth. These would then drop down to reveal the specific details about that first route development, with a clear message that you can only pick one route. Once that route has been chosen, the rest of that route's development options are shown in it's place.
